Saintpaulias, which grow from 6–15 cm tall. The leaves are rounded to oval, finely hairy, and have a fleshy texture. The flowers are 2–3 cm in diameter, and grow in clusters of 3–10 or more on slender stalks. Wild species can have violet, purple, pale blue, or white flowers.
